作 者:张慧[1] 赵宗胜[1] 赵凤[1] 余鹏[1] 班谦[1] 王遵宝[1]
机构地区:[1]新疆石河子大学动物科技学院,石河子832000
出 处:《畜牧兽医学报》2012年第2期306-313,共8页ACTA VETERINARIA ET ZOOTECHNICA SINICA
基 金:国家自然科学基金资助项目(30660125)
摘 要:为探讨中国美利奴羊不同甘露(聚)糖结合凝集素(MBL)型个体感染绵羊肺炎支原体的免疫应答变化,对4种不同MBL型个体进行MBL水平测定,选择其中20只作为对照组,50只为试验组,在相同饲养条件下试验组人工感染绵羊肺炎支原体,分别在攻毒前1d(-1d)、攻毒后1d(1d)、1周(7d)、2周(14d)、3周(21d)用ELISA方法定量分析血清中TNF-α、IFN-γ、补体C1、C3水平。结果显示,A型和B型其MBL浓度较低,C型MBL浓度较高,与对照组相比,在攻毒后1周,A型和B型IFN-γ表达显著降低(P<0.05),攻毒后2周,补体C3表达显著降低,TNF-α升高显著(P<0.05);与A型和B型相比,在攻毒后1周,C型IFN-γ表达增加(P<0.05),在攻毒后2周,补体C3表达增加、TNF-α显著降低(P<0.05),补体C1各组均不显著。结论:低血清MBL浓度与绵羊支原体肺炎有一定的相关性,不同基因型之间其TNF-α、IFN-γ、补体C1、C3水平有差异,低浓度MBL绵羊更易发生比较严重的炎症反应。The aim of this study was to analyze the immunological response to Mycoplasma pneu- monia in Chinese Merino Sheep with different MBL genotype. MBL levels were measured in the four different individuals, 50 healthy Chinese Merino sheep with different genotypes were artifi- cally infected with M. pneumonia under the same raising condition, while 20 sheep were the con- trol group, the content of TNF-a, IFN-Υ, C1, C3 in the serum were quantitatively assayed by EL1SA on 1 day before infection (-1 d), and on 1 (the day of infection), 7, 14 and 21 day. The results showed that. 1)A and B type had low concentration of MBL, while C type's MBL level was higher 2) One week after infection, the percentage of IFN-Υ in the MBL A and MBL B was significantly lower than that of control group(P〈0.05), two weeks later, the level of C3 was lower and the TNF-a was significantly higher(P〈0.05). Compared with the MBL A and MBL B at one week after infection, the level of IFN-7 was significantly higher in the group of high con- centration of MBL, two weeks later, the level of C3 increased and the level of TNF-Υwas signifi- cantly lower (P〈0. 05), the percentage of C1 had no significant difference among the groups (P〉0.05). Conclusion: there maybe some correlation between the lower concentration of MBL plas- ma and mycoplasma pneumonia, while there were some difference among the level of TNF-α,IFN-Υ)', C1, C3, the low MBL ones were likely to have more severe inflammatory response.
